The Chan Soon-Shiong Institute of Molecular Medicine at Windber (wriwindber.org) has been part of several major national cancer programs, including TCGA and the Cancer Moonshot Initiative. The institute is expanding and is hiring for multiple new Bioinformatics Scientist positions - at the Murtha Cancer Center Research Program (MCCRP) office in Bethesda, MD to join an experienced and highly collaborative team of clinicians, scientists, statisticians, and bioinformaticians in the fight against cancer The level of the position will be considered based on candidate's experience.

Key Responsibility:

  • Assess diverse clinical, genomic, and proteomic datasets from public domain and internal sources, for discovery as well as designing new projects
  • Support projects in the areas of study design, data QC, bioinformatics and statistical analysis, and data management
  • Perform analysis of proteogenomic data along with clinic-pathologic data in large cohorts, and synthesize and interpret results for presentations and publications
  • Develop or adopt innovative methods and metrics for data QC and predictive model
  • Promote the scientific interests of the institute through publication and community interaction

Requirement:

  • PhD degree in Bioinformatics or another relevant field, or a MS degree with minimum 3 years of direct experience in bioinformatics, statistics, or computational biology
  • Familiar with NGS applications for variant detection/interpretation and gene expression
  • Sound scientific logics for tertiary analysis and interpretation, backed by publications
  • Strong understanding of concepts and analytical techniques in statistics.
  • Proficient in R or another common statistical package.
  • Intermediate with Python or another scripting language
  • Familiar with Linux environment
  • Excellent in written and verbal communication in a collaborative environment
  • Self-motivated and good time management with evolving priorities

Desired: 

  • Experience in translational research or clinical trials, involving genomics or proteomics
  • Solid knowledge of cancer biology and cellular pathways
  • Familiar with public resources for cancer research and medical genetics
  • Experience with computation and data management in a cloud environment
  • Familiar with relational database or/and object-oriented database
